Patients who want impressive results from Brazilians who are thin Will need liposuction from many areas. This could include upper abdomen, lower abdomen, waist, hips, arms, back, inner thighs and inner knees . To have 10 areas treated with liposuction and then undergo fat transfer is in lengthy procedure. If done under general Anastasia the price for the operating room and anesthesiologist alone could be Half of your budgeted amount. I personally perform most liposuction and fat transfer procedure without general anesthesia which does give it some cost savings. Brazilians have some of the most distorted patient expectations of any cosmetic surgical procedure. There are several reasons for this. One reason is some providers will post pictures taken immediately after the procedure. Fat transfer it's a procedure that requires 6 to 12 months before final results are seeing it. Areas will often look substantially bigger early on because of swelling and before some of the fat has been re-absorbed. Setting expectations correctly from the beginning is key for developing long-term high patient satisfaction.
